SSD Operating Temperatures


Temperature Measurements

A relatively weaker point of a small-sized from factor M.2 NVMe SSD may be thermals. Under extreme workloads, many users worry about performance drops due to heat generation. You can bypass that greatly by using a heat spreader. However NVMe SSDs these days also have active thermal throttling if the controller or NAND gets too hot. Performance can go down, but that prevents overheating. We test a product the way it arrives, without a heatsink.
